You are right on, here Roy, there aren't very many FCC Field Agents left
who actually have done this type of Enforcment Work, but there are a few.
Also there aren't many Field Agents left who can do the required
Calibration on the required Instruments, either, but there are a few.
Mostly the Field Staff spends its time doing Safety of Life and Property
Interference Work, these days, and filling out the Federal Paperwork
required to keep the few Field Offices left, open.
